Objectives of the Course |
The aim of this course is to educate undergraduate students with the ability to do basic scientific research and to be able to read and understand scientific researches. |

Learning Outcomes |
1 | Explain the basic concepts of scientific research. Defines science and scientific knowledge. Explain the functions of scientific knowledge. Interprets the aims of scientific knowledge. Explain the stages of a scientific research. Recognize the characteristics of the research problem. Explain the characteristics of quantitative and qualitative research approaches. Compares quantitative and qualitative research approaches. Recognizes data collection tools. Compares data collection tools according to research objectives. Recognizes data analysis techniques. Have the knowledge and equipment to interpret a scientific research and to design and perform a small research. Examines and interprets a scientific research. Designs a small scientific research. He/she carries out the research he/she has designed. He reports his research. Recognizes ethical rules in scientific research. He pays attention to ethical rules in his research. Develops a positive attitude towards science and scientific research. |
